Enter common state data

Another control feature you can use is Common State in combination with Column Filter. This gives you the ability to quickly enter common data, such as modifications and income adjustments, for multiple entities. Select your entities as columns or rows and then enter modifications and adjustments for each entity.

Use common state with column filter

  1. Go to
    Data Entry
    .
  2. Select the
    Year
    .
  3. Select
    Common State
    .
  4. For
    Filing Group
    , select from the list or
    None Selected
    .
  5. Select either
    Actual
    (YTD) or
    Forecast
    . Actual is the system default.
  6. In the Rows category, select Entry Items or Entities.
    • If you select
      Entry Items
      , then the Column Filter lists all the available entities.
    • If you select
      Entities
      , then the Column Filter lists all the entry items.
  7. In the
    Column Filter
    category, you can change the way entry items and entities are displayed. Select the items or remove the items you wish to see.
  8. Once you have made your selections, select
    Load
    to see the Data Entry workpaper.
  9. Enter data on the Data Entry workpaper. You can use the
    Copy
    and
    Paste
    commands to copy data from an Excel spreadsheet and then paste it into your workpaper.
  10. Select
    Save
    when you're finished entering data.
